### 1. Create Content Type Guidelines
|
|
|
|
For each content type, provide specific guidance:
|
|
|
|
**UI Microcopy** (buttons, labels, errors):
|
|
- Keep it short
|
|
- Use active voice
|
|
- Be specific about actions
|
|
|
|
**Marketing Content** (headlines, features):
|
|
- Lead with benefits
|
|
- Use power words from tone guide
|
|
- Connect to user driving forces
|
|
|
|
**Informational Content** (services, about):
|
|
- Answer user questions directly
|
|
- Include relevant keywords naturally
|
|
- Maintain consistent tone
|
|
|
|
### 2. Document Content Ownership
|
|
|
|
Ask: "Who will create and update content?"
|
|
|
|
| Content Type | Owner | Frequency |
|
|
|--------------|-------|-----------|
|
|
| Service descriptions | [owner] | Rarely |
|
|
| Blog/news | [owner] | [frequency] |
|
|
| Translations | [owner] | As needed |
|
|
|
|
### 3. Create Writing Checklist
|
|
|
|
Compile a practical checklist:
|
|
- [ ] Tone matches guidelines (warm, professional, etc.)
|
|
- [ ] Language is appropriate for target audience
|
|
- [ ] Keywords included naturally
|
|
- [ ] All languages updated (if multilingual)
|
|
- [ ] Spelling and grammar checked
|
|
- [ ] Accessible language (no jargon without explanation)
